How they compare

Cyprus currently reports 397,895 current LCU per square kilometre against 385,543 current LCU per square kilometre in El Salvador, a difference of 12,352 current LCU per square kilometre.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 49 shared years of data; in 1975 it was El Salvador ahead.

Cyprus ranks 150th and El Salvador ranks 151st of 205 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Cyprus averaged higher in 3 and El Salvador in 3.
